1 Chronicles 7:13 Meaning and Commentary

1 Chronicles 7:13

The sons of Naphtali: Jahziel, and Guni, and Jezer, and
Shallum
Called Shillem, ( Genesis 46:24 ) ,

the sons of Bilhah;
Jacob's concubine; her grandsons; for Naphtali, the father of them, was her son; from these sprung so many families, after their names, ( Numbers 26:48 Numbers 26:49 ) .
